Nobuye (Nobi) Zaran, age 90 of Wyandotte, Michigan passed away on Friday, April 20, 2017. Born on August 3, 1926 in Tacoma, Washington, she was the daughter of Kumataro and Asako (Ikegami) Suyama. Nobi worked for many years as a colorist for Powell Studio in Detroit, Michigan. She loved spending time with her family and friends, as well as, rooting for Detroit and MSU sports teams, especially the Tigers, Lions, and Spartan football and basketball. While petite in stature, Nobi cast a very long shadow and served as an inspiration for three generations of Zaran, Mathis, Bertchinger, and Suyama children. Nobi is preceded in death by her husband Frank, her mother and father, her brother, Minoru (Min) Suyama and her son-in-law, Bobby Mathis. She is survived by her daughters, Darlene Mathis and Pamela (Richard) Bertchinger, her sons, Frank (Anne) and David (Lori), her grandchildren, Brian, Jamie, Jennifer, Bobby, Sarah, Emily, Michael, Rachel, David ("Alex"), Morgan, Natalie, and her great-grandchildren, Kinzy, Katlin, Erika, and Zachary, her nieces and nephews, Sharon, Patricia, Kay, and Mark, and their children and grandchildren, and by her dear sister-in-law, Sally Suyama.
